We are seeking an experienced and dynamic Office Admin to join our team. Deliver a best-in-class in-office experience by welcoming guests, coordinating employee events, and ensuring seamless scheduling across leadership, hiring, and team development activities. This role serves as the central hub of the office—supporting day-to-day operations, enabling executive effectiveness, and fostering a positive, connected workplace environment.

Requirements

  • 2–4+ years in an administrative, office management, or coordinator role
  • Fluent in both Spanish and English (spoken and written)
  • Ability to translate clearly and professionally in real-time conversations
  • Proficiency in Google Workspace (Calendar, Gmail, Sheets, Docs) or similar tools
  • Experience with scheduling tools and basic administrative systems

Nice To Haves

  • Experience supporting executives and/or managing office operations preferred

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the first point of contact for visitors and employees, creating a professional, welcoming, and organized office environment.
  • Manage the President’s calendar, coordinating meetings, prioritizing requests, and ensuring efficient use of time.
  • Coordinate interviews, trainings, and new hire orientations, ensuring a seamless and timely experience for candidates and employees.
  • Plan and execute in-office events, supporting team engagement and reinforcing company culture.
  • Provide Spanish-English translation during employee interactions, including supporting employee relations conversations when needed.
  • Support day-to-day administrative needs including mail, supplies, vendor coordination, and general office organization.
